- Acropolis - The Acropolis is the most renowned ancient landmark in Athens and a symbol of classical Greece. At its summit stands the Parthenon, a temple dedicated to the goddess Athena.
- Panathenaic Stadium - The Panathenaic Stadium is among the most historic sports venues globally. Constructed entirely of marble, it hosted the inaugural modern Olympic Games in 1896. A brief stop at the Panathenaic Stadium allows for admiration of this historic site, capturing stunning photos, and enjoying the view of the world’s only stadium made entirely of marble. It is a unique location where the Olympic Flame begins its journey to the Games.
- Plaka - Plaka is one of Athens’ most enchanting neighborhoods. Situated at the base of the Acropolis, its narrow streets are lined with traditional tavernas, cozy cafés, and vibrant shops. It is the ideal place to explore and immerse oneself in the city’s rich history and lively atmosphere.
- Syntagma Square Fountain - At Syntagma Square in Athens, visitors can observe the ceremonial changing of the guards in front of the Hellenic Parliament. The guards, known as ‘Evzones,’ wear traditional uniforms and perform a slow, precise march. This symbolic ceremony, occurring every hour, signifies the nation’s respect for its history and the safeguarding of democracy.
- Mount Lycabettus - Lycabettus Hill provides one of the finest panoramic views of Athens. Visitors can capture breathtaking photographs of the city, including the Acropolis, Syntagma Square, and the distant Aegean Sea. It is an ideal spot for unforgettable pictures, particularly at sunset.
- Propylaea - The Propylaea is a remarkable central building of the National and Kapodistrian University of Athens and is part of the historic Athenian Trilogy, along with the Library and the Academy of Athens. Constructed in the 19th century in the neoclassical style, they were designed by Danish architect Christian Hansen, symbolizing the revival of education in the newly established Greek state.
